Em 13-06-2012 15:18, Tiago Valério escreveu:
>     PostgreSQL 9.1.2 on amd64-portbld-freebsd8.2, compiled by cc (GCC)
>     4.2.1 20070719  [FreeBSD], 64-bit

Considere atualizar o mais rápido que puder pra 9.1.4. Dezenas de bugs 
corrigidos na última atualização. E são bugs bem críticos.

>
>     Comece colocando log_autovacuum_min_duration = 0 para saber todas as
>     reais execuções em log. Fica mais fácil de fazer tuning com mais
>     informações.
>
>         2012-06-13 15:20:26.410 BRT,,,2277,,4fd8d5be.8e5,3,,2012-06-13
>         15:02:38 BRT,30/6932,0,LOG,00000,"automatic vacuum of table
>         ""corepj.pg_catalog.pg_index"": index scans: 1

(...)

>     Você pode alterar os parâmetros de autovacuum individualmente, por
>     tabela, mas a forma de fazer isso varia entre as versões mais antigas e
>     mais novas do PostgreSQL.
>
> Tentamos fazer isto para pg_catalog.pg_attribute mas a operação não nos
>   foi permitida.Não é possivel alterar tabelas do pg_catalog.

É verdade.

Pergunto: você atualizou usando o pg_upgrade? Se sim, a partir de qual 
versão? E qual versão do pg_upgrade?

Comece tentando fazer:
1) ANALYZE VERBOSE em todo o seu banco de dados e inclua o pg_catalog nisso;
2) VACUUM FREEZE na tabela em questão.

Se nada acima resolver, talvez seja necessário entrar com seu problema 
na lista internacional.

[]s

Flavio Henrique A. Gurgel
Consultor e Instrutor 4Linux
Tel: +55-11-2125-4747
www.4linux.com.br
_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a